The ingredients needed to make Mackerel Cooked with Miso:
- Make ready 2 mackerel fillets
- Make ready 2 cups water for blanching mackerel
- Prepare 10 g ginger (peeled and sliced thinly)
- Get 150 cc water
- Prepare 70 cc sake
- Get 1 1/2-2 Tbsp sugar
- Make ready 2 1/2 miso(put in the bowl)

Steps to make Mackerel Cooked with Miso:
- Bring water to a boil in a pan. Have ice water ready in a bowl. Blanch one fillet for 30 seconds and immediately plunge it into the ice water. Repeat with the other fillet. Pat the mackerel dry with paper towels.
- Combine water, sake, sugar into a pan and bring to a boil, then put in ginger and the mackerels with the skin side up and cook over medium-high heat. Remove the scum.
- Turn off the heat once. Dissolve miso in a ladleful of the step ②'s soup in the bowl. Put the miso back in to the pan, turn on the medium heat again, once boiled, after that lower the heat and simmer until the liquid is almost gone, about 10 mins.
